Microsoft expects to launch Windows 8.1 later this year, reportedly available as a free upgrade for current Windows 8 users.ĭOWNLOAD: AMD Catalyst Windows 8.1 Preview Driver Windows 8.1 brings some enhancements to PC graphics, with support for Microsoft's own standardized wireless display technology 48 Hz dynamic refresh rates for video playback, V-sync interrupt optimization, video conferencing acceleration, and a new instruction to the DirectX 11.1 API, named "tiled resources." Like the operating system itself, AMD's Windows 8.1 Preview Catalyst driver is a beta, and its use comes with no warranties. GPUs based on AMD's Graphics CoreNext architecture will be supported by Windows 8.1 over WDDM 1.3, while older VLIW4 and VLIW5-based GPUs (Radeon HD 6000 series and older), will be supported over older WDDM 1.2 based drivers.
Windows 8.1 features an upgraded display driver model, WDDM 1.3, which lets users take advantage of a few new features.
